The Magic Link Not Working: Troubleshooting Guide

The "magic link" is a popular method for user authentication, offering a secure and convenient way to log in without needing to remember passwords. However, like any technology, it can sometimes encounter problems. This article will explore common reasons why your magic link might not be working and offer solutions to get you back on track.

Understanding Magic Links

Before diving into troubleshooting, let's understand how magic links work. When a user requests to log in via a magic link, the system generates a unique, time-limited link and sends it to the user's email address. Clicking this link authenticates the user and logs them in, eliminating the need for a password.

Common Reasons for Magic Link Failure

1. Incorrect Email Address: The most common reason for a non-working magic link is a simple typo in the email address provided. Double-check the email address entered during registration or login.

2. Spam Filter: Magic link emails may be flagged as spam by your email provider's spam filters. Check your spam folder, or try adding the sending domain to your safe sender list.

3. Expired Link: Magic links are typically time-limited to enhance security. If the link has expired, you'll need to request a new one.

4. Server-Side Issues: Occasionally, problems may arise on the server side, preventing the magic link from being generated or delivered correctly.

5. Email Client Problems: Some email clients, like Gmail or Outlook, might block or delay email delivery, preventing the magic link from reaching your inbox.

Troubleshooting Steps

Here are some steps to troubleshoot a non-working magic link:

1. Check your email address for typos. Ensure the email address you entered is correct.

2. Check your spam folder. Look for the magic link email in your spam folder.

3. Request a new magic link. Most systems allow you to request a new link if the previous one has expired or failed to arrive.

4. Clear your browser cache and cookies. Sometimes, outdated browser data can interfere with link functionality.

5. Use a different email client or device. Try sending the magic link to a different email client or device to see if it's an issue with your current setup.

6. Contact Support: If the problem persists, it's best to contact the website or app support team. They can diagnose the problem and provide further assistance.
